Shares of Samsung Electronics jumped as much as 6% on Monday following the news that the company has started shipping samples of its HBM4E memory chips to customers worldwide. The HBM4E is a next-generation high-bandwidth memory chip designed specifically for artificial intelligence applications, offering higher bandwidth and improved power efficiency compared to previous generations. The shipment marks a key milestone in Samsung’s efforts to compete in the AI semiconductor market, where rival SK Hynix has taken an early lead with its HBM3E products. While sample shipments do not guarantee mass production or immediate revenue, the development signals that Samsung is narrowing the technological gap. Trading volume was notably elevated during the session, reflecting heightened investor interest. The company has not disclosed the names of the customers receiving the samples or the expected timeline for volume production. The broader market reacted positively, with Samsung’s shares recouping some of the losses seen in recent months amid a global semiconductor slowdown. The shipment of HBM4E samples could allow Samsung to capture a larger share of the AI memory market, which is projected to grow significantly as demand for AI training and inference workloads expands. HBM4E is expected to deliver bandwidth improvements of up to 30% compared to the current HBM3E standard, making it a critical component for high-performance AI accelerators. This development may intensify competition with SK Hynix, which already supplies HBM3E to Nvidia, and Micron, which has also announced its next-generation HBM products. However, market observers note that sample shipping is an early stage; successful qualification by customers and subsequent volume ramp-up are necessary before Samsung can generate meaningful revenue from HBM4E. The timing of mass production remains uncertain and could be influenced by customer demand and manufacturing yields. Additionally, geopolitical factors and export controls may affect the supply chain for advanced memory chips. The positive market reaction suggests investors are betting on Samsung’s ability to close the gap in the AI memory race, but the company still faces execution risks. From an investment perspective, the surge in Samsung’s shares reflects growing confidence in its AI memory strategy, yet cautious analysis suggests that any earnings impact from HBM4E may not materialize until late 2025 or 2026. Investors should consider that the memory market is cyclical, and Samsung’s profitability also depends on broader trends in DRAM pricing and demand. The competitive landscape remains fluid: while Samsung’s HBM4E samples are a positive step, SK Hynix has a head start in customer relationships, particularly with Nvidia. Furthermore, technological leaps in AI chips could shift memory requirements rapidly. The news underscores Samsung’s commitment to investing in advanced manufacturing and R&D to maintain its leadership in memory semiconductors. However, potential risks include production delays, lower-than-expected adoption rates, and price competition from rivals. Overall, the development suggests that Samsung is moving in the right direction, but investors may want to monitor progress on customer qualifications and volume shipments before drawing conclusions about the stock’s long-term trajectory.
